Why is GEO important in 2026?


AI engines pull information from reliable and experienced sources. They rewrite the answer using the content they trust the most. If your brand is not included in those sources, you won’t appear in AI responses. That means you lose visibility, even if your website ranks well on Google.

Traditional SEO alone cannot guarantee presence in AI results. GEO fills this gap. This is why every founder and every SEO agency is now shifting toward GEO practices.

How GEO Works?


AI tools read content differently from Google. They don’t rank pages. They scan for:

  • Clear structure
  • Direct answers
  • Verified information
  • Brand authority
Then they combine this and create a short, helpful response.
To be included, your content must show strong EEAT signals.

Experience


Share real stories, results, and what you’ve learned while working with clients.

Expertise


Explain concepts in a simple and confident way.

Authority


Use data, examples, or case studies to show you know what you’re talking about.

Trustworthiness


Avoid clickbait. Keep the content honest and fact-driven.

When AI sees these signals, it picks your content more often and includes your brand in the generated text.
